Location: Oncology Department - 791 Summit Ave, Oconomowoc, WI 53066 Primary Responsibilities: Greets visitors and patients in person Handles confidential information appropriately by protecting and disclosing information to only those authorized Prioritizes by assessing and analyzing information to identify immediate emergency needs Demonstrates technical knowledge and competence in the departmental procedures and maintains current physician on - call schedules to ensure appropriate communication to ProHealth Care Physicians Enters and updates patient demographic and financial information, ensuring the patient is fully registered as early in the process as possible Obtains appropriate applications and forms, confirming signatures are on file. Photocopies / scans documents as needed Provides patients with financial responsibility information and collects patient liabilities, document amounts in the appropriate fields, and balances the cash box daily Works with partnering departments (Financial Counseling, Scheduling, Financial Clearance, and clinical areas) to ensure all aspects of the patient's encounter are completed as needed Provides wayfinding instructions and assists with hospital information as requested Meets or exceeds audit accuracy standards
